St. Patrick's Day Pub Crawl 2020 In Haddon Township

The St. Patrick's Day Pub Crawl in Haddon Township will take place over the course of two days.

HADDON TOWNSHIP, NJ — St. Patrick’s Day is quickly approaching. This year, the holiday — celebrated every year on March 17 — falls on a Tuesday, and Haddon Township's annual Pub Crawl will take place over two days.

It will take place on March 14 and March 17, 2 p.m. to 10 p.m. There will be free jitney service from all locations including:

  • Keg & Kitchen;
  • Pour House;
  • Treno Pizza Bar;
  • Brewer's Towne Tavern;
  • Central Taco & Tequila;
  • PJ Whelihan's;
  • Tap Room & Grill;
  • Tom Fischer's Tavern;
  • Haddon Square; and
  • The Westmont PATCO train station.

There will be Irish fare, live music, contests and more. Admission is free. The event is sponsored by the Haddon Township Business Improvement District. For more information, call 856-833-6267 or click here.

The American celebration of St. Patrick’s Day started as a minor religious holiday in 1631, according to National Geographic. The church declared it a feast day, and over time the day became associated with Irish-American tradition.

The annual holiday is celebrated on March 17 as it is the traditional death date of Saint Patrick.
The color green didn’t become connected with the day until the Irish Rebellion of 1798 — when Irish soldiers chose to wear green — since it was the color that most contrasted with the red British uniforms.
